然而,實際上有時候你隻需要一個簡單的指令行工具,運作一個簡單的指令就能提供同樣的資訊。
如果你的系統中還沒有安裝 nmap,在你的發行版中運作合适的指令來安裝:
<code>$ sudo yum install nmap [在基于 redhat 的系統中]</code>
<code>$ sudo dnf install nmap [在基于fedora 22+ 的版本中]</code>
<code>$ sudo apt-get install nmap [在基于 debian/ubuntu 的系統中]</code>
安裝完成後,使用的文法是:
<code>$ nmap [scan type...] options {target specification}</code>
其中,{target specification}這個參數可以用主機名、ip 位址、網絡等來替代。
<code>$ ifconfig</code>
<code>或者</code>
<code>$ ip addr show</code>

在 linux 中查找網絡細節
接下來,如下運作 nmap 指令:
<code>$ nmap -sn 10.42.0.0/24</code>
查找網絡中所有活躍的主機
上面的指令中:
<code>-sn</code> - 是掃描的類型,這裡是 ping 方式掃描。預設上,nmap 使用端口掃描,但是這種掃描會禁用端口掃描。
<code>10.42.0.0/24</code> - 是目标網絡,用你實際的網絡來替換。
要了解全面的資訊,檢視 nmap 的手冊:
<code>$ man nmap</code>
或者不帶任何參數直接運作 nmap 檢視使用資訊摘要:
<code>$ nmap</code>
原文釋出時間為:2017-12-08
本文來自雲栖社群合作夥伴“linux中國”